Nailard Surname Meaning

variant of Naylor with excrescent -d.

Source: The Concise Oxford Dictionary of Family Names in Britain, 2021

Where is the Nailard family from?

You can see how Nailard families moved over time by selecting different census years. The Nailard family name was found in the UK in 1891. In 1891 there were 19 Nailard families living in Sussex. This was about 48% of all the recorded Nailard's in United Kingdom. Sussex had the highest population of Nailard families in 1891.
